Brief description

In the Sustainable Energy Systems program at TU Ilmenau, you will first acquire a solid foundation in the natural sciences and engineering, including physics, electrical engineering, mathematics, and chemistry. This will enable you to understand and evaluate sustainable technologies for energy supply. You will then learn the interdisciplinary fundamentals of sustainable energy systems, power systems, electrochemistry, and thermodynamics. You can shape a large part of your studies and your individual path yourself through a very extensive range of electives, but you can also use suggestions and model paths for your studies as a guide. In particular, you can develop your skills in the specialization areas of ‘Renewable Energy Technology’, ‘Electric Power Systems’ or ‘Electrochemistry’. Mentors provide you with individual support as you navigate your way through your studies.

The program also includes a large proportion of project-related courses from the outset. Here, you will be gradually introduced to working on natural science and engineering projects. This includes, in particular, the ability to communicate in the field of energy technology. Your studies will thus open up a particularly wide range of career prospects for you.

Practice during studies

Practical experience during your studies: The practical aspect runs through the entire program, beginning in the first and second semesters with laboratory courses in physics, chemistry, and electrical engineering. In “Sustainable Development,” also in the first semester, local sustainability problems are analyzed and solved in a project-based manner. In the third semester, a practical project on sustainable energy communication is planned. Through research projects and project work in the last two semesters, students learn and apply the implementation of natural science and engineering projects in the field of sustainability, with the project work in the last semester leading directly to the bachelor's thesis.
